The themes within Chicano literature short stories are very telling. For instance, the theme of migration is common. It tells the story of the Chicano people's journey from Mexico to the United States, and all the hardships they faced along the way. Another theme is the search for equality. These stories show how Chicanos strive for equal opportunities in education, work, and social life. They are not just stories, but a representation of the real - life struggles and hopes of the Chicano community.

Chicano literature short stories often reflect the unique experiences of the Chicano community. They can cover themes like cultural identity, the struggle between different cultures, and the search for a sense of belonging. For example, many stories might talk about the challenges of growing up in a bicultural environment, dealing with discrimination, and trying to preserve Chicano heritage while also adapting to the mainstream American culture.

The themes in Indian literature short stories are highly significant. For instance, the theme of family is central. Family in Indian culture is not just a unit of related people but a complex web of relationships and responsibilities. In short stories, this is often explored through the conflicts and reconciliations within families. Another important theme is the search for identity. With India's diverse cultures and religions, characters in short stories are often on a journey to find out who they really are.

Some common themes in Chicano short stories are cultural identity. Chicanos often explore their mixed Mexican - American heritage. Family also plays a big role, like the relationships between generations. Another theme is the struggle against discrimination and the fight for a place in American society.

In literature, slave short stories are crucial. They help to break the silence around the horrors of slavery. By reading them, we can see the different ways slaves coped with their situation. Some stories might describe the small acts of rebellion, like slowing down work or feigning illness. This shows that even in the most difficult circumstances, slaves had agency and fought back in their own ways.

Characteristics of the best Chicano short stories include their exploration of the immigrant experience. Since many Chicanos have roots in Mexico and are living in the US, these stories show the challenges of adapting to a new country while still holding onto one's native culture. They also often use a lot of imagery related to the land. The landscape, whether it's the arid deserts or the fertile fields, becomes a symbol of the Chicano people's connection to their heritage. Additionally, the stories frequently have a sense of community, where the characters rely on and support one another in the face of difficulties.
